Finalize The BOUNDARIES of Your SYSTEM
4
In our previous presentation we
mentioned some key requirements of the new
standard:
X
To re-cap, we have grouped a number of elements into
what we call
DEFINING THE BOUNDARIES OF OUR QMS
We contend that this is the most important part of our
QMS
As per the previous tutorial, considerations
also include:
x
By defining our boundaries, we determine what our scope of services is and thus what market we
serve.
It is also implied that we determine what market we
do NOT serve.
This simplifies our definition of processes, and
frees us to focus on the outputs concerned.
Thus this section allows us to TARGET our processes.

Tackling these eight areas will serve as the “glue” for
our QMS
As per our previous tutorial:
Another way of putting it is that these considerations
will help to align our processes and let them
“talk” to each other.
The last thing we want is processes that act as
“silos”.
